Transaction 62f80f3b4bebc50da3d8e418adf24c20512d0dd28ae2e306d2e37be585b8b4e9

1 Input
2 Outputs
  • 62f80f3b4bebc50da3d8e418adf24c20512d0dd28ae2e306d2e37be585b8b4e9:0
  • value  5756520
    address  14reu8EAxeZAicko7Fv1CxLtFVJ9o4778L
  • 62f80f3b4bebc50da3d8e418adf24c20512d0dd28ae2e306d2e37be585b8b4e9:1
  • value  47135914
    address  17EBRNQr9LCKKVS86hA2mwmfKoHexaAzJC